In GetAmped (and GetAmped 2), a "skin link" typically refers to the digital file or URL used to import a custom character design into the game. These skins change your character's head, face, and body textures.

Skin Files: Usually shared as specialized game files (like .skin or image textures) that the game's internal editor can read.

Skin Forest: This is the official in-game marketplace where players upload skins for others to vote on or purchase.

External Repositories: Many veteran players share high-quality skins via Discord communities or fan wikis like the GetAmped2 Dojo Wiki . How to Use a Skin Link

To apply a skin you've found via a link or download, follow these general steps:

Download the Skin: Save the skin file (often a PNG or a specific game format) to your computer.

Open the Skin Edit Tool: Launch GetAmped and navigate to the "Skin Edit" section.

Import the File: Use the "Load" function within the editor to browse your local files and select the downloaded skin.

Apply to Character: Once loaded, you can preview the skin and apply it to your character's head or body. Creating Your Own Custom Skins

The Role of Skins in GetAmped

Unlike typical character skins that are simple color swaps, GetAmped skins can fundamentally change your character's head, face, and body geometry.

Customization: Using the in-game Skin Edit Tool, you can draw directly onto 3D textures or remodel the head shape.

Integration: Skins are applied to your chosen Style (class), which determines your base stats and move set.

Sharing: The community often shares skins via direct download links or through the in-game Skin Forest, where creators can upload their work for others to buy or vote on. Finding and Using Skin Links

In the GetAmped community, "skin links" usually refer to external URLs (like Mediafire, Google Drive, or specialized forums) where creators host their .skin or .skin2 files.

In the series, particularly GetAmped 2 , "linking" a skin typically refers to the process of uploading your custom creation to the game's servers or sharing the specific .skin2 file via external links. The Skin Editing & Upload Process

The hallmark of GetAmped is its robust Skin Editor, which allows players to create highly detailed, 3D custom avatars from scratch.

File Format: GetAmped 2 specifically uses the .skin2 file format. Note that older files ending in .skin (from GetAmped X or Splashfighter) are generally incompatible with the sequel.

The Skin Forest: This is the official in-game hub for "linking" and sharing skins. You can upload your finished designs here for other players to view, vote on, or purchase.

External Linking: Many creators share their work on community forums or Discord servers by providing direct download links to their .skin2 files. How to Use a Skin Link

If you have a link to a custom skin file, follow these steps to use it:

Download: Save the .skin2 file from the provided link to your computer. Open Skin Editor: Access the in-game Skin Edit Tool.

Import: Use the "Open" or "Import" function within the editor to load the downloaded file.

Save/Equip: Once loaded, you can further customize the skin or save it to your character slot to equip it in battles. Community & Resources
